Hoogewerf Finishes As Manchester United Joint-top Scorer In Mercedes-Benz Junior Cup 2020
Published: January 06, 2020
Netherlands U17 international of Nigerian descent Dillon Hoogewerf was the joint-top scorer for Manchester United at the recently concluded Mercedes-Benz JuniorCup 2020, an honour he shared with Mark Helm.
The Red Devils took a 12-man group for the tournament in Germany, with two other players of Nigerian descent, Shola Shoretire and Ayodeji Sotona, part of the traveling party.
United ended the group stage with two wins, beating Porto and Borussia Moenchengladbach 2-1 and 1-0 respectively before losing 1-0 to VfB Stuttgart.
On day two, the English side drew 2-2 with Rapid Vienna and lost 4-0 to RB Leipzig, thus missing out on a semifinal spot.
In the classification game, Manchester United beat Eintracht Frankfurt on penalties following a 2-2 stalemate in regulation time, with Hoogewerf netting both goals for the Old Trafford outfit.
The diminutive striker, who was signed from Ajax Amsterdam last summer, opened his goalscoring account in the tournament against Rapid Vienna.
The Mercedes-Benz JuniorCup 2020 was won by Rapid Vienna who thrashed RB Leipzig 4-0 in the final.
